Transaction 2d4426e39c468a116121fa4e566a149bacee00cf41cc39c3b670dccafdb65681
1 Input
1 Output
-
2d4426e39c468a116121fa4e566a149bacee00cf41cc39c3b670dccafdb65681:0
- value
- 14841865
- script pubkey
- OP_0 OP_PUSHBYTES_32 8e61a4fddcbfb9334d6bfe913ee5f42a7cecff9ed9b03fcbd1cffecb66eee802
- address
- bc1q3es6flwuh7unxnttl6gnae059f7welu7mxcrlj73ellvkehwaqpqgfqrhs